"It is worth highlighting," CLSA analyst Christopher Wood writes in the latest issue of his Greed & Fear research note, "that an interesting development occurred recently when the 10-year Australian government bond yield in late February declined below the US 10-year Treasury bond yield for the first time since 2000." This development is interesting because it comes against a backdrop of rising leverage in Australia in an economy that's highly dependent on the housing to generate growth.
